Aquaculture in the Desert: Challenges and Triumphs
Establishing a successful aquaculture operation in the heart of the Taklamakan Desert has been a monumental undertaking, fraught with countless obstacles and setbacks. From the scarcity of freshwater resources to the extreme fluctuations in temperature, the team of Chinese innovators has had to overcome a seemingly endless array of challenges to bring their vision to life.
One of the most daunting hurdles has been the need to create a self-sustaining water supply in a region where rainfall is virtually non-existent. By tapping into the Tarim River Basin’s vast network of underground aquifers and implementing advanced desalination and water recycling technologies, the team has been able to establish a reliable and renewable source of freshwater to support their thriving fish farms.
Another critical challenge has been the selection of fish species that can thrive in the harsh desert environment. After extensive research and experimentation, the team has identified a number of hardy, drought-resistant species that are capable of withstanding the extreme temperatures and limited resources of the Taklamakan. From sturdy carp to resilient tilapia, these aquatic champions have proven their mettle in the face of adversity, setting the stage for a new era of desert-based aquaculture.

What makes the Taklamakan Desert so inhospitable for traditional farming?
The Taklamakan Desert is one of the harshest and driest environments on Earth, with scorching temperatures, relentless winds, and virtually no rainfall. These extreme conditions make it highly challenging for traditional land-based farming to thrive, as there is a severe lack of water resources and arable land.
How do the desert fish farms address the water scarcity issue?
The desert fish farms have addressed the water scarcity issue through the implementation of advanced desalination and water recirculation technologies. By tapping into the Tarim River Basin’s underground aquifers and utilizing solar-powered desalination plants, the farmers are able to create a sustainable and renewable source of freshwater to support their aquaculture operations.
